Find Vietnamese Restaurants
Near: West Babylon
- Lindenhurst Vietnamese Restaurants
- North Babylon Vietnamese Restaurants
- Wyandanch Vietnamese Restaurants
- Copiague Vietnamese Restaurants
- Amityville Vietnamese Restaurants
- Farmingdale Vietnamese Restaurants
- West Islip Vietnamese Restaurants
- Deer Park Vietnamese Restaurants
- Massapequa Park Vietnamese Restaurants
- Melville Vietnamese Restaurants